Lead Consultant
Location: Melbourne
Key Roles and Responsibilities
Act as lead consultant and Solution designer, delivering large-scale solutions in the banking and finance industry, including payment systems, loan management system design and implementation.
Drive Agile delivery across projects using frameworks such as Scrum, SAFe, and Kanban, ensuring timely and high-quality outcomes.
Work with cloud platforms (Azure, AWS, GCP) and GenAI solutions to design and optimize enterprise‑grade applications.
Manage risk identification and mitigation strategies, ensuring compliance with local financial regulations.
Collaborate with stakeholders to define technical requirements and deliver high‑value projects aligned with business objectives.
Skills and Knowledge
Banking & Finance Expertise: Deep understanding of financial systems, lending platforms, and regulatory requirements.
Digital Transformation & System Migrations: Proven track record in modernizing legacy systems and implementing scalable solutions.
Database Expertise: Strong knowledge of database migration, upgrading legacy databases, and optimizing performance.
Data & Analytics: Hands‑on experience with SQL databases, QlikSense, and Splunk for insights and monitoring.
Cloud & Infrastructure: Design and implement patching solutions on AWS and Azure; support tasks related to EC2, S3, RDS, Load Balancer, Route53, SSM, restoration, patching, and performance tuning.
Automate security agent installation in Golden AMI processes and set up centralized FinOps dashboards for cost optimization.
Risk Management: Ability to identify, assess, and mitigate risks throughout the software development lifecycle.
Stakeholder Engagement: Strong communication and collaboration skills for managing senior stakeholders and cross‑functional teams.
Must Have
Proven experience creating solutions for streamlined deployments and governance.
Expertise in optimizing operational efficiency across AWS, GCP, and Azure environments.
Strong capability in formulating and documenting technical solutions as per business requirements.
Extensive experience in cloud operations support and cloud migration.
Demonstrated success in delivery leadership and stakeholder engagement.
